Let me first say that I am working with Vex programing for teh FVC compatition. I have tried several times to get my ultrasonics working together. I have tried putting a print to screen for each and they work individually, however, when I try to put them both together they will not work. Can anyone help me with my problem?

Jackel,

Each sensor must be on its own interrupt line and digital output line. Also, you must stagger the output pulse so that both will not transmit a pulse at the same time.

Your are probable having the 2 sonars interfere with each other both physically and in the timing subroutines. Don't know how you have them set up and what your measuring, but you could mount one sonar on a servo. Point in 1 direction read it , move to another direction and read it.

Here is a code fragment for managing 3 ultrasonic sensors:

int Service_Ultrasonic_Sensors (void)
{

ultra_counter++;
switch (ultra_counter) // Process Ultrasonic Transducer
{
case 1:
for (pulsecount = 0 ; pulsecount < PULSE_WIDTH ; pulsecount++)
{
rc_dig_out10 = 1; // Make another pulse
};
rc_dig_out10 = 0; // The pulse is over
break;
case 2:
for (pulsecount = 0 ; pulsecount < PULSE_WIDTH ; pulsecount++)
{
rc_dig_out11 = 1; // Make another pulse
};
rc_dig_out11 = 0; // The pulse is over
break;
case 3:
for (pulsecount = 0 ; pulsecount < PULSE_WIDTH ; pulsecount++)
{
rc_dig_out12 = 1; // Make another pulse
};
rc_dig_out12 = 0; // The pulse is over
break;
case 4:
if (ultra_left_flag == TRUE)
{
INTCONbits.GIEL = 0; // Disable Low Priority Interrupts
ultra_left_time = ultra_left_stop - ultra_left_start;
INTCONbits.GIEL = 1; // Enable Low Priority Interrupts
ultra_good_count++;
}
else
{
ultra_left_time = -1;
ultra_bad_count++;
};
if (ultra_front_flag == TRUE)
{
INTCONbits.GIEL = 0; // Disable Low Priority Interrupts
ultra_front_time = ultra_front_stop - ultra_front_start;
INTCONbits.GIEL = 1; // Enable Low Priority Interrupts
ultra_good_count++;
}
else
{
ultra_front_time = -1;
ultra_bad_count++;
};
if (ultra_right_flag == TRUE)
{
INTCONbits.GIEL = 0; // Disable Low Priority Interrupts
ultra_right_time = ultra_right_stop - ultra_right_start;
INTCONbits.GIEL = 1; // Enable Low Priority Interrupts
ultra_good_count++;
}
else
{
ultra_right_time = -1;
ultra_bad_count++;
};
ultra_left_flag = FALSE;
ultra_front_flag = FALSE;
ultra_right_flag = FALSE;
ultra_counter = 0;
break;
default: // for any unexpected result
ultra_left_flag = FALSE;
ultra_front_flag = FALSE;
ultra_right_flag = FALSE;
ultra_counter = 0;
break;
};

}

The code above can be called once per communications loop or via a timer interrupt, et cetera...

the variables ultra_bad_count and ultra_good_count were used during development and can be deleted.

An example interrupt routine is:

void Service_DIO4_Interrupt(unsigned char state)
{
if (state == 1) // rising-edge interrupt
{
ultra_front_start = Read_Timer_3 (); // Read Start Time.
}
else // falling-edge interrupt
{
ultra_front_flag = TRUE;
ultra_front_stop = Read_Timer_3 (); // Read Stop Time
}
}


The user routine has only to test for the time to be greater than zero to know that it is valid data.
